Stay of recovery of tax demand - AO stay asking to the assessee to pay 50% of the outstanding demand in 18 equal monthly instalments. - the assessee has not complied with the order of the AO - Assessee failed to get relief from CIT(A), CCIT, CBTD - Conditional stay granted - AT
